On March 17, 2023, a Navion NAVION A (N610) was involved in an accident near Mesa, AZ. The accident resulted in 1 serious injury, with 3 people uninjured out of 4 aboard. The aircraft sustained substantial damage.
The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this accident to be: The pilot of the Ryan Navion’s failure to maintain visual sight of and clearance from another airplane during a formation flight, which resulted in a mid-air collision.
